Sales & Marketing Director

Unity Advisory


Date: 3 weeks ago
City: London
Contract type: Full time
To lead the commercial engine of Unity Advisory — shaping and executing a go-to-market strategy that quickly attracts the right clients, scales our impact and builds an iconic brand that redefines the category of advisory-as-a-platform.

Responsibilities

  • Build a revenue-first marketing engine: Own and execute the marketing strategy that directly fuels our pipeline growth — from first impression to closed deal. Map every stage of the buyer journey and design campaigns that move prospects forward with speed and intent. Help us to recruit our Ideal Client Profile clients for the journey.
  • Bridge sales and marketing: Work hand-in-glove with service line leaders to align on targeting, qualification, lead handover, and pipeline acceleration. Treat lead-flow like a product, and optimise it relentlessly.
  • Maximise ROI: Manage the marketing budget and external agency relationships with a CFO mindset. Every pound spent should move the dial.
  • Create content that converts: Lead the development of high-impact content — from thought leadership to sales enablement — that resonates with CFOs, COOs and transformation leaders. Specifically, help us to redefine the professional services category.
  • Shape the Unity brand: Own corporate communications and media strategy to build a challenger presence in the advisory space. Be the “go-to” for journalists, influencers, and market voices.
  • Run the digital storefront: Be the custodian of Unity’s website, LinkedIn presence, and social footprint — ensuring every channel converts, informs, and differentiates. For example, define our LLM-optimisation strategy in addition to traditional SEO activities.
  • Own internal comms: Work with leadership and function heads to run internal communications and help build a culture aligned with our external promise.
  • Guard the brand: Maintain brand consistency across all touchpoints, channels, decks, and campaigns — with clarity, simplicity, and impact.
  • Prove what works: Measure, report, and optimise every campaign and tactic. Use data to double down or kill fast.
  • Turn client feedback into fuel: Implement always-on, tech-enabled feedback loops to listen, learn, and act.
  • Champion AI-powered sales enablement: Lead the rollout of AI-powered campaigns, prospecting, and pipeline tooling. Improve forecast accuracy, drive cross-sell/upsell, and make the commercial engine smarter.
  • Be a connector: Build strong cross-functional relationships with delivery, product, and leadership. Be as comfortable in a boardroom as in a browser tab.

Qualifications

  • 7+ years in commercial marketing and sales-aligned leadership roles, ideally in professional services, SaaS, or platform businesses.
  • Tech-native, data-driven: proficient in AI sales and marketing tools, CRM platforms, marketing ops, website performance and campaign analytics
  • Proven track record of designing and executing client targeting strategies that drive measurable pipeline and revenue growth
  • Deep experience with multi-channel campaigns across content, digital, social and field marketing — with a sharp sense for what works and what doesn’t
  • Skilled at campaign orchestration and funnel performance, not just awareness-building
  • Strong communicator and leader: able to inspire cross-functional teams and external partners in high-speed environments
  • Familiar with PR, media engagement, and brand storytelling in B2B markets: experience managing agencies, budgets, and teams with high standards and correspondingly high returns
  • Comfortable building from scratch and iterating fast — this is a builder role, not a maintainer role
  • Hands-on, energetic, and intellectually curious — with a commercial mindset and zero interest in waiting around for permission. A self-starter, proactive, team player who thinks ahead.
